Major depressive disorder (MDD) is a leading cause of disability worldwide, and many patients experience only partial improvement with antidepressant treatment alone. Increasing evidence suggests that the gut-brain axis plays an important role in the pathophysiology of depression. Psychobiotics, including Lactobacillus helveticus and Bifidobacterium longum, may improve depressive symptoms by modulating the gut microbiota, reducing inflammation, and influencing neurochemical pathways.
This study is a randomized, double-blind, placebo-controlled trial designed to evaluate the efficacy and safety of adjunctive psychobiotic therapy in adults with MDD receiving standard antidepressant treatment. Participants will continue their prescribed antidepressant medication and will be randomly assigned to receive either a psychobiotic capsule containing Lactobacillus helveticus and Bifidobacterium longum or a matching placebo once daily for 6 weeks.
Depression severity will be assessed at baseline, Week 3, and Week 6 using validated rating scales. Safety and tolerability will be evaluated through adverse event monitoring, treatment adherence, and regular follow-up visits.
The primary objective is to determine whether adjunctive psychobiotic therapy produces a greater reduction in depressive symptoms compared with placebo. Secondary objectives include evaluating safety, tolerability, treatment adherence, patient satisfaction, and quality of life. The findings will provide evidence on whether psychobiotics are an effective and safe adjunct to antidepressant therapy in adults with major depressive disorder.
